Approach-focused care for online therapy
Suzie draws on Attachment-Based Therapy to help clients understand how early relationships shape current patterns. This approach explores attachment styles and relational wounds to support people dealing with intimacy difficulties, abandonment worries, and repeated relationship challenges.She also uses Client-Centered Therapy, offering a warm, non-judgmental stance that prioritises the client’s own goals and pace. This approach is useful for building self-esteem, improving communication, and creating a supportive space to process life transitions.
